Unmatched Fuel Efficiency for Optimal Cost Management

Fuel expenses constitute a significant portion of operational costs in shipping, directly impacting profitability. The Wärtsilä 31 engine sets a new benchmark for fuel economy, offering unparalleled efficiency across its entire operating range. Whether at full throttle or during low-speed cruising, the engine maintains optimal performance, ensuring minimal fuel consumption under all conditions.

Available in 8 to 16-cylinder configurations, with power outputs ranging from 4.6 MW to 10.4 MW and speeds of 720 or 750 rpm, the Wärtsilä 31 adapts seamlessly to diverse vessel requirements. Its advanced design—featuring optimized combustion chambers and precision fuel injection systems—maximizes energy utilization, delivering tangible savings for operators.

Power Density: Maximizing Space and Profitability

Space efficiency is critical onboard, where every square meter translates to potential revenue. The Wärtsilä 31’s exceptional power density—achieving up to 650 kW per cylinder in diesel mode—minimizes engine footprint, freeing up valuable space for cargo, passengers, or auxiliary systems. Its compact, lightweight construction further enhances vessel performance by reducing overall weight and lowering installation costs.

Fuel Flexibility: Preparing for Future Regulations

As environmental mandates evolve, fuel adaptability becomes indispensable. The Wärtsilä 31 offers diesel, dual-fuel (DF), and pure gas variants, enabling operators to select the most economical and compliant option. Dual-fuel models significantly cut emissions—including an 85% reduction in methane slip—while maintaining full power output. This flexibility future-proofs investments against regulatory shifts and price volatility.

Environmental Leadership: Meeting and Exceeding Standards

When operating on gas, the Wärtsilä 31 complies with IMO Tier 3 emissions standards without additional systems. Diesel versions achieve Tier 3 with selective catalytic reduction (SCR). Optional ultra-low emission packages further reduce methane slip and nitrogen oxides, positioning vessels as leaders in sustainable shipping.
